Method

Noodles & Sauce

1

Cook noodles

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. If using fresh egg noodles, blanch 30–45 seconds until just pliable; if using dried, cook 3–4 minutes until al dente. Drain and rinse under cold water to stop cooking. Toss with 1 teaspoon neutral oil to prevent sticking and set aside.

2

Mix sauce

In a small bowl combine 2 tbs light soy sauce, 1 tsp dark soy sauce, 1 tbs oyster sauce, 1 tsp sesame oil and 1 tsp white pepper. Stir until homogenous and set aside.

Protein

3

Toss the thinly sliced chicken with 1 tsp light soy sauce and 1 tsp cornstarch until evenly coated. Let sit 5–10 minutes while preparing vegetables. Heat 1 tablespoon oil in a wok or large sk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ken in a single layer and stir-fry until just cooked through, about 3–4 minutes. Remove chicken to a plate and reserve any brown bits in the pan.

Vegetables & Aromatics

4

Increase heat to high and add remaining 2 tablespoons oil to the wok. Add the sliced onion and stir-fry 30 seconds until slightly softened. Add minced garlic and the white parts of the scallions; stir 15–20 seconds until fragrant (do not burn). Add julienned carrot and cabbage and stir-fry 1–2 minutes until vegetables are crisp-tender.

Combine & Finish

5

Add the cooked noodles and reserved chicken back to the wok. Pour the prepared sauce over the top. Using tongs or two spatulas, toss and stir quickly to evenly coat the noodles and distribute ingredients. Stir-fry for 1–2 minutes, allowing sauce to caramelize slightly and noodles to pick up color from the wok.

6

Taste and season with 1/2 tsp salt and 1/2 tsp sugar, adjusting as needed. Add the butter if using and toss until melted and glossy. Add the green parts of the scallions and give one final toss.

7

Transfer to a serving platter and serve immediately while hot.
